Ulf Zimmermann wrote: > > Hello, > > I updated via cvsup (cvsup from tuesday afternoon PDT), I went into > single user mode, did make world, make buildkernel KERNEL=FOURTYTWO > and make installkernel KERNEL=FOURTYTWO. Everything but one thing > I can find seems to work fine, but ps doesn't. Did you boot /FOURTYTWO or do the rename sequence to make it kernel? It sounds like your kernel and world might be a little out of sequence.
